Zorluk: Çok zorSpermatophytes: Gymnosperms and Angiosperms

Unlike angiosperms, which enclose their ovules within an ovary that matures into a fruit and feature a reduced female gametophyte (embryo sac) lacking archegonia, gymnosperms produce exposed ovules on megasporophylls and develop distinct archegonia within their female gametophytes.

The statement is TRUE.
The statement accurately highlights key evolutionary and anatomical distinctions: angiosperms enclose ovules in ovaries that form fruits and have an 8-nucleate female gametophyte (embryo sac) without archegonia. Gymnosperms bear naked ovules on megasporophylls and form archegonia within their female gametophytes.

Analyze ovule and seed enclosure in Gymnosperms versus Angiosperms.
Gymnosperms bear exposed (naked) ovules on megasporophylls or cones, whereas angiosperms enclose ovules within carpels/ovaries that mature into protective fruits.
Ovary enclosure of ovules is a fundamental anatomical distinction of angiosperms.
2
Examine female gametophyte structure and archegonia presence.
Gymnosperms develop multicellular female gametophytes containing archegonia (female sex organs), whereas the angiosperm female gametophyte is reduced to an 8-nucleate embryo sac completely devoid of archegonia.
Evolutionary reduction of gametophytes in angiosperms eliminated discrete archegonia.
